# Brackenmill Thumbnail Queue — Environments

The Brackenmill service renders thumbnails for the Oatwhistle media library across three environments: dev, staging, and prod. Each environment runs its own worker pool and broker; queues are never shared. Reviewers checking queue-related changes should validate against staging, which mirrors prod sizing. Staging currently runs with the following configuration.

service settings:
PRAIX_LOG_LEVEL=error
PRAIX_METRICS_HOST=metrics.praix.qorvelcorp.corp
PRAIX_POOL_SIZE=16

Leadership Review Briefing — Insurance Renewal

Our property and liability policies with Thornegate Mutual renew next quarter. Premiums are up 11%, driven by claims at the Ashvale depot. We obtained a competing quote from Larkspur Assurance at a 4% saving, though with higher deductibles. Recommendation is to renew with Thornegate for one year while we improve our loss record. One related note follows.

board note of tadup-tajog: Headcount on the Oliiel team goes from 31 to 88 by the end of February. Gross margin on Oliiel came in at 62 percent against a plan of 29 percent.

## 2.8.0 — Changelog

Renamed `THUMBQ_WORKER_TOKEN` to `THUMBQ_QUEUE_SECRET` for the Pellbrook thumbnail generation queue. Old name is ignored as of this release; workers started with it will idle forever. Update any local env files before running the queue consumer. Retry backoff defaults unchanged. If thumbnails stall, check the rename first — it's the usual cause. Set the new variable in your .env as shown below.

vault entry, yagaf-tawip: LEDGER_TOKEN13=50ca479f745b8